Hyundai Motor America has announced a donation of $150,000 to the Children's Hospital Los Angeles (CHLA) for its Injury Prevention Program, which focuses on enhancing child passenger and pedestrian safety. This collaboration aims to run more car seat check events and LA Street Smarts initiatives, educating children about safety protocols. Hyundai's initiative, part of its Hyundai Hope corporate social responsibility program, aligns with efforts to reduce injuries and fatalities associated with car crashes and pedestrian incidents.
Notably, almost half of car seats are incorrectly installed, and effective use significantly decreases fatality risks among young children. The partnership will incorporate community education to spread awareness and promote safety practices.
Hyundai Motor America has extended its partnership with One Tree Planted to plant an additional 200,000 trees across North America, bringing the total to 350,000 trees since the partnership began in 2022. The announcement was made during a tree planting event in Denver on Earth Day, April 22, 2023. The initiative aligns with Hyundai's IONIQ Forest project, focusing on sustainability and reforestation.
Hyundai has also donated two IONIQ 6 electric vehicles to support the tree planting efforts. This partnership reflects Hyundai's commitment to combatting climate change and investing in electrification, aiming to introduce 11 new EV models by 2030.

Hyundai Motor has extended its title sponsorship of the World Archery Championships and Archery World Cup for an additional three years, solidifying a decade-long partnership initiated in 2016. The upcoming events will be held in Berlin in 2023 and Gwangju in 2025. Hyundai has also been named the World Archery Federation's first sustainability partner, committing to carbon neutrality and social responsibility goals.
This partnership enhances Hyundai's ongoing support for archery, exemplified by its long-standing relationship with the Korea Archery Association since 1985. The 2023 edition is a key qualifier for the Paris 2024 Olympic Games.
Hyundai Motor America has partnered with AAA insurers to provide insurance options for owners of certain Hyundai vehicles affected by a rise in thefts. This initiative aims to assist customers struggling to obtain auto insurance due to increased criminal activities targeting their vehicles. The insurance program will be available in most states, with details accessible at AAA.com/insurance.
In addition, Hyundai is expediting a free software upgrade to enhance anti-theft measures for nearly 4 million vehicles, available two months earlier than planned. Affected owners can also receive reimbursement for steering wheel locks if their vehicles cannot accommodate the software upgrade. All Hyundai vehicles produced after November 2021 come with engine immobilizers as standard.
DEEPX has announced a strategic partnership with Hyundai Motor Company and Kia Corporation to develop AI semiconductor technology for robot platforms. This collaboration, formalized through a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) on March 24, 2023, aims to enable mass production readiness of DEEPX's AI chips, crucial for the anticipated growth of the global smart mobility market, projected to reach $145 billion by 2027.
The partnership will leverage DEEPX's four AI semiconductor models, backed by over 150 patents, which are known for high performance and low power consumption. Initial Proof-of-Concept tests demonstrated superior AI accuracy and efficiency, paving the way for AI integration in robotic applications.
The 2023 Hyundai Tucson Plug-in Hybrid has been named the Best Plug-in Hybrid by U.S. News & World Report for the second consecutive year. This recognition was based on comprehensive evaluations of 107 vehicles across various categories, where the Tucson distinguished itself with its superior quality, competitive pricing, Level 2 charging capabilities, and impressive EPA-rated fuel economy and range.
Olabisi Boyle, vice president at Hyundai, emphasized the vehicle's efficient powertrain and stylish design, catering to diverse lifestyle needs. The Tucson Plug-in Hybrid is noted for its responsive performance, offering a 33-mile electric driving range, high-quality interior, spaciousness, and affordability, making it a prime choice in the PHEV market.
